Glyphosate-based herbicides have transformed vegetation management across multiple sectors since the 1970s. Glyphosate 71 SG represents a significant advancement in this legacy—a soluble granular formulation offering enhanced handling properties and efficacy. Engineered to dissolve completely in spray tanks without clogging nozzles, this 71% glyphosate concentration provides an optimal balance between potency and application safety.
Unlike older glyphosate formulations requiring specialized surfactants, Glyphosate 71 SG incorporates superior built-in activating agents. This technical refinement enables consistent translocation to root systems across varying water conditions. Data from Oregon State University Field Trials (2023) demonstrates a 17% higher systemic absorption rate compared to conventional liquid concentrates when treating perennial weeds like Canada thistle.

Regional agronomy teams report significantly different results based on usage patterns. Vineyard managers in California's Napa Valley achieve 95% Johnson grass suppression using Glyphosate 71 SG at 3.2 lb/acre with directed sprays. Transportation agencies provide compelling evidence of Glyphosate 71 SG's economic impact. After switching from potassium salt formulations, the Colorado DOT documented:
"38% reduction in retreatments along I-70 corridor slopes through effective root kill. This translated to $213,000 annual savings over 400 miles through reduced application frequency and diesel consumption."
Commodity cotton farms in Georgia demonstrated complementary benefits. Applications during stubble management phases accelerated residue decomposition by 8 days versus comparable treatments. Soil sensors confirmed no persistent glyphosate accumulation beyond EPA detectable thresholds when applied per label instructions.
For effective vegetation control while ensuring environmental compliance, integrate Glyphosate 71 SG into early-season management cycles targeting actively growing weeds. Apply when target species have 4-6 true leaves for optimum translocation. Combine with cultural controls such as cover cropping to reduce long-term dependence on chemical interventions.
Spray system calibration remains critical—ensure even particle distribution within 0.7-1.0 meters from nozzles. Where aquatic environments border treatment zones, utilize drift reduction nozzles to limit overspray beyond intended boundaries. Follow EPA-prescribed buffer distances to protect sensitive ecosystems while achieving effective invasive species control.

A: Glyphosate 71 SG is a herbicide formulated to control weeds and grasses in agricultural, industrial, and residential areas. It is a soluble granule formulation for easy mixing and application. Always follow label instructions for safe and effective use.
A: Glyphosate 5.4 Aquatic is specifically designed for use near water bodies to manage invasive aquatic weeds. It is EPA-approved for aquatic applications when used as directed. Avoid excessive runoff to minimize ecological impact.
A: Standard glyphosate products are non-selective and will damage lawns by killing both weeds and grass. Use selective herbicides labeled for lawns instead. Glyphosate is only suitable for spot treatments in areas where complete vegetation removal is desired.
